Exodus 13:6-8
New American Standard Bible 1995
6 For (A)seven days you shall eat unleavened bread, and on the seventh day there shall be a feast to the Lord. 7 Unleavened bread shall be eaten throughout the seven days; and (B)nothing leavened shall be seen [a]among you, nor shall any leaven be seen [b]among you in all your borders. 8 (C)You shall tell your son on that day, saying, ‘It is because of what the Lord did for me when I came out of Egypt.’

Exodus 13:6-8
New International Version
6 For seven days eat bread made without yeast and on the seventh day hold a festival(A) to the Lord. 7 Eat unleavened bread during those seven days; nothing with yeast in it is to be seen among you, nor shall any yeast be seen anywhere within your borders. 8 On that day tell your son,(B) ‘I do this because of what the Lord did for me when I came out of Egypt.’
